OK, Goa isn't an Island. The Goan authorities are training 100 lifeguards (about 40 are female) to patrol the beaches of Goa. These lifeguards will hopefully go a long way to preventing the dozens of drowning that occur each monsoon season to (normally) Indians taking a break in Goa. --------------------- Regarding these 100 lifeguards........
